    Medina

    Medina, situated between Bellevue and Seattle, is known for its luxury estates and stunning views of Lake Washington and Mt. Rainier. The neighborhood features several parks and outdoor spaces, including Medina Park with its ponds and off-leash dog area, and Medina Beach Park, which offers a serene atmosphere and scenic sunset views.     Bel-Red

    Bel-Red, located between Bellevue and Redmond, is a bustling neighborhood with a strong commercial, retail, and corporate presence. Downtown Bellevue is just a few miles away, while Redmond is 5 miles to the northeast and Downtown Seattle is about 11 miles away.
